There are the occasional level where the left turn rule is more of an 'eventually correct' rule than an 'always correct' rule... but it's just luck of the draw. We as a species are excellent at spotting patterns, even if there aren't any.
Would also add it's important to notice the difference between the way the door is facing and the way the tile is facing. Sometimes the door sprite is facing the opposite way of the tile, or perpendicular to the tile. The predictable map mechanics are based on tiles, and to your specific question, no, I haven't noticed any issues at all with the tower. Sometimes they just wrap.
